MyWi OnDemand is a new cool Cydia app which lets you create an iPad to iPhone connection quicly. Using this app, all you need is a jailbroken iPhone running MyWi OnDemand app and an active 3G/EDGE data plan on your iPhone.
MyWi OnDemand connects when you need it, and disconnects when you don’t. When you leave your WiFi connection at home and you’re using the iPad, the iPad will connect automatically. When you turn your iPad screen off, or go back where you have WiFi, MyWi OnDemand will disconnect. After a simple pairing, everything works automatically! Will work with 3G/3GS/4 iPhones/iPod Touches (3.1.2+) and iPad (3.2+). Requires purchase of MyWi 4.0.
Features of MyWi OnDemand:-
- On Demand connection for an iPod Touch, iPad or iDevice that needs a internet connection
- Set and Forget! Hotspot is always on while not using any more power than just leaving on low-power bluetooth
- Hotspot controls who is able to connect and may “kick” any devices at will.
- Uses much less battery then wifi tethering and uses native routing to minimize battery

MyWi OnDemand is available on Cydia via ModMyi repo for $24.99, but if you already have MyWi app, you can download OnDemand for $4.99 as upgrade.
